Zhuo Zhi is a back-end software engineer and database specialist with 8 years of experience, based in Sunnyvale, California. He contributes to the high-profile open-source TiDB project, focusing on partition pruning, query optimization, and robustness improvements like point get and batch get correctness tests. With an MS in Computer Science from UC San Diego and a BE in Electrical Engineering from Xi'an Jiaotong University, he blends rigorous academic training with practical systems engineering. His work improves performance and correctness in cloud-native distributed SQL databases, a niche that requires deep understanding of query planners and storage semantics. Notably, he has implemented targeted optimizations for hash, range, and list partitions that reduce unnecessary predicates and streamline query paths. He pairs research-driven problem solving with production-focused implementation to make large-scale databases more reliable and efficient.

Contributions summary:Zhuo primarily contributes to the TiDB database, focusing on implementing and improving partition pruning and query optimization. They have worked on pruning hash partitions, removing unnecessary predicates, and implementing point get functionality for range and list partition tables. The user has also added correctness tests related to point gets, batch gets, direct reading, and different join operations, thus improving the overall reliability of the TiDB system.
